I was watching a HS stream last night and this guy was creating a deck for arena by using a website... does everyone who play arena do this? I always wonder why I get my ass handed to me when I play that mode lol.
 
Until you learn how Arena works, it's definitely a good idea to use a site like ArenaValue to avoid picking rubbish cards (no one good will ever draft Silverback Patriarch or Eye for an Eye, unless offered utter bilge, two cards I saw played earlier by the same person), and follow some basic drafting rules about 2-drops, 4-drops and big guys to make sure you can contest the board early and curve out. But a really strong Arena player knows the game well enough to know better than a generic value aggregator what's best for their deck and approach.

I would pick boulderfist ogre. You have so much early game already that picking autobarber or backstab can actually hurt your deck. You only have 5 minions of 5+ cost so far and boulderfist is pretty much the best 6 drop you can hope for. And the way drafts tend to work out now is that you may not get another premium high cost minion making your late game very weak.

You have to think about curve more than simply what the best card is when you're that late into the draft and frankly I don't think the draft is good with only 1x 3 drop, 3x 4 drops, and 5x 5+ drops. Maybe you got lucky and they gave you the cards you need to round it out well, but with only azure drake as card draw, I think you're going to run out of steam pretty fast.
